When I emerged, he was asleep so I simply slid in with him, cuddling up and sleeping comfortably beside him. I was shaken awake a few hours later. Glancing up, I noted Rae’s wet hair and the fact that he was dressed. “Put something… provocative on,” he murmured softly, “First we’re going to go to my place, then dinner for you, and finally a surprise.” He grinned at me as I climbed from the bed, pulling on an outfit I had hidden from my mother—I had worn it on other dates with Azrael.

He stalked over, sliding his arms about my waist, resting on my hip bones and growling in appreciation. “I miss clothes like this, babe. How much longer til you move out?” I laughed, leaning against my boyfriend for a moment before admitting, “I’ve missed them too; I like feeling sexy every once in a while.”

Azrael leaned forward, whispering, “you always look sexy to me, beautiful.” I could not help but flush as he pulled away, putting his trench around me. “As much as I’d love to see you like that, most people at the restaurant and Victor, shouldn’t, so wear it until my surprise.” I nodded, pulling it on, even though it was much too long, and then leading Rae out of the house, locking it behind us.

We walked towards his house, hands interlaced. Once home, he changed quickly, wearing a tight, revealing outfit much like my own. He pulled on a second trench coat—how many of those did he have?—and we headed out.

The restaurant was not terribly fancy, but it was certainly better than anything my mom and I could afford. After dinner, he told me to close my eyes and trust him. I did, of course. He led me through the town and as we slowed, I heard pound music. He pulled away, whispering for me to wait for a moment. I waited obediently, eyes shut tightly until his arm wrapped about my waist and his lips pressed against my ears. “Come on, babe, I’ve already paid,” he informed me, guiding me up some steps and into a noisy, stuffy room. He told me I could open my eyes, so I did.

The club was dark and unfamiliar. Many people were dancing, and a few were at the bar. I had been to several clubs with my lover, but this was a new one. With his hand resting on the small of my back, he guided me past the dance floor and into a private room. I glanced about the fairly lavish room, surprised to find a bottle of alcohol waiting.

The place was full, with the exception of the room we were in. “Love… how’d you score this place?” I asked curiously. I knew my boyfriend had money, but he rarely splurged and it had to have cost a lot to get a room like this. However, I rather wanted to dance, and I said as much. He chuckled, “We can go dancing in a few minutes, Lucas, but first I want my drink.” I blinked, “Drink?” I had not noticed him getting anything to drink.

I shrugged, reaching over to grab the bottle of tequila for myself since I doubted Azrael could even drink it. If he was having a drink, than I might as well. I found a small glass, lime slices and salt beside it and poured a shot. I rarely drank, but I knew how. I downed it, laughing at the look I got. “I’m not completely innocent, you know. So, what are you drinking?” Rae smirked, arching an eyebrow, “Bloody Mary. Lots of blood.” He chuckled, closing his eyes and settling back. “They serve blood here? How… how many vampires come here?” He shrugged, amused by my disbelief.

~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~Azrael’s POV~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

I was amused by his question. To be honest, nearly half the beings in the club were vampires, and most of the mortals there knew they were vampires. What my lover did not know was that his club, Buena Noche, was one of several lucrative businesses that I owned. Then again, most of the employees did not know, few had ever seen me in that role. The room had been paid for, but the money would eventually get back to me anyway. I was glad to see that the club was thriving, and that the place still served blood. I needed it pretty badly, I had not fed that night, and I felt tired and a little sluggish—I disliked the feeling—especially since I wanted to enjoy my light with my lover.

Soon enough, there was a knock. I answered it, taking the dark liquid from the server and downing it in the doorway. “One more,” I directed, “but I’ll be on the dance floor, so look for me there.” I turned to my angel, offering my hand. “Shall we dance, beloved?”

He grinned, shedding his coat and nodding happily. I removed my own as well, before leading him down to the dance floor with the mass of vampires and mortals. My hand slid protectively around Luc’s waist, leaning forward. “I may bite you… it’s a possessive thing. I promise I won’t take much. I just don’t want someone making an attempt to steal you.” He laughed, twisting in my arms. “Fine with me, as long as your body is pressed against mine and you dance with me.”

I smiled, sliding my hands down his side, “then dance, gorgeous.” I pecked his neck before beginning to move to the beat. One hand remained on Lucas’s hip, the other going over my head. Luc let his body grind against mine, turning back to face me. His arms went about my neck, hips pressed against my own. I leaned forward, pressing my lips to my lover’s. I was content to dance with the young mortal until I noticed Victor walk in, Olivia only a few steps behind.

I frowned; annoyed that she had quite possibly ruined the night. I could not risk her finding out about Lucas, it would put him at risk. I nipped his ear before completely pulling away. “Babe, head back up to the room,” I directed him over the crowd, waiting to see him disappointedly making his way through vampires and mortals alike. Once sure he had made it safely, I made my way over to the bar. I informed the man that was working to keep his eye on the pair. He hesitated but once he heard my name, he nodded in agreement.

I would need to know if they were making new contacts. I had not forgotten that meeting and what I had learned about the young female. Once satisfied that my request would be fulfilled, I took my second drink—remembered only once I had shown my face, so someone was in trouble. I headed to the room, my eyes narrowing at a vampire preparing to feed on a mortal against the door. The couple moved off and I slipped inside. “Babe, how’s it going,” I asked, seeing a pout on his lips.

“Why’d we have to stop?” he whined. I chuckled, moving to pull him up from the couch. “Because I wanted to dance in private,” I lied, pulling him close and holding him. The music was muted but it was enough to dance to. I leaned forward to give the other a deep, searing kiss.
